func MessageHasBoolExtension(msg *descriptor.DescriptorProto, extension *proto.ExtensionDesc) bool { … } func SetBoolMessageOption(extension *proto.ExtensionDesc, value bool) func(msg *descriptor.DescriptorProto) { … } func TurnOffGoGetters(msg *descriptor.DescriptorProto) { … } func TurnOffGoStringer(msg *descriptor.DescriptorProto) { … } func TurnOnVerboseEqual(msg *descriptor.DescriptorProto) { … } func TurnOnFace(msg *descriptor.DescriptorProto) { … } func TurnOnGoString(msg *descriptor.DescriptorProto) { … } func TurnOnPopulate(msg *descriptor.DescriptorProto) { … } func TurnOnStringer(msg *descriptor.DescriptorProto) { … } func TurnOnEqual(msg *descriptor.DescriptorProto) { … } func TurnOnDescription(msg *descriptor.DescriptorProto) { … } func TurnOnTestGen(msg *descriptor.DescriptorProto) { … } func TurnOnBenchGen(msg *descriptor.DescriptorProto) { … } func TurnOnMarshaler(msg *descriptor.DescriptorProto) { … } func TurnOnUnmarshaler(msg *descriptor.DescriptorProto) { … } func TurnOnSizer(msg *descriptor.DescriptorProto) { … } func TurnOnUnsafeUnmarshaler(msg *descriptor.DescriptorProto) { … } func TurnOnUnsafeMarshaler(msg *descriptor.DescriptorProto) { … } func TurnOffGoExtensionsMap(msg *descriptor.DescriptorProto) { … } func TurnOffGoUnrecognized(msg *descriptor.DescriptorProto) { … } func TurnOffGoUnkeyed(msg *descriptor.DescriptorProto) { … } func TurnOffGoSizecache(msg *descriptor.DescriptorProto) { … } func TurnOnCompare(msg *descriptor.DescriptorProto) { … } func TurnOnMessageName(msg *descriptor.DescriptorProto) { … }